Ko wai matou About us: Taumata Arowai is the water services regulator for Aotearoa New Zealand. It is a Crown entity governed by a Minister-appointed Board and advised on Maori interests and knowledge by Te Puna, a statutory Maori Advisory Group.
Our responsibilities are to protect and promote drinking water safety and related public health outcomes - we regulate drinking water suppliers on behalf of the public. We also have an oversight role in relation to the environmental performance of drinking water, wastewater, and stormwater networks.

Mo tenei turanga mahi About this role: Our Senior Investment Analyst will provide analysis and advice on infrastructure investment by regulated parties and the cost of complying with rules and standards.
The Senior Investment Analyst will:

Lead the assessment of investment plans produced by regulated parties alongside technical advisors.
Monitor the cost of compliance at supplier and sector scales, including the underlying drivers of operating and capital costs.
Provide analysis and advice into investment trends and the benefits and costs of compliance as part of the development of regulatory instruments, guidance, training, and systems to support the regulatory framework.
